I am not certain that the brand really matters but I prefer a high capacity digital scale with NO memory. Sometimes the ones with a built in memory do not show the very small losses. I was never heavy enough that I HAD to buy a high capacity scale but they stand up to more wear and tear.

This is the one I have. I know the decription is off, but it is a 400 pound capacity.

I've had the same scale since being banded 9 years ago... it's a Tanita and it is still going strong. You can can put your hieght i and save for 3 users and it calulates your body fat %. It may be a little outdated now... but it never wavers in the weight it gives me... some scales I would get a different weight if I got on 3 times in a row! When it dies... which will probably be never at this rate I will probably get the same brand. :)

I have the Fitbit Aria. It doesn't track hydration but does body fat %, it's accurate and automatically syncs to MyFitnessPal or the Fitbit site. I love the scale since I also use the Fitbit so it was a no brainer. I also have a plain EatSmart scale, it doesn't measure anything but weight though, but it's also super accurate.
